AN innovative new £340,000 housing development has been opened in Spreyton by local housing provider West Devon Homes.
The estate, called Daveys Platt, will provide urgently needed affordable housing for families in the area.
A West Devon Homes spokesperson said: ?The project is the result of the hard work, commitment and persistence of Spreyton Parish Council, which, with the assistance of the Community Council of Devon, organised a Community Appraisal in 1999.
?The outcome found that people were leaving the village due to the lack of affordable housing options.?
The appraisal led to plans for the construction of Daveys Platt, which received a tremendous boost after a local landowner stepped in to offer reasonably priced land for development of the scheme.
West Devon Borough Council, in association with the Housing Corporation, provided grant funding of £170,000 and West Devon Homes secured private funding to ensure completion of the
development.
Daveys Platt is designated an exceptions site under National Planning Policy, meaning that the properties must provide homes solely for local families.
There are other affordable housing schemes planned after the opening of the Spreyton development, including some currently under construction in Tavistock, Lifton and Okehampton.
